2H-Benzimidazole-2-thione,5-fluoro-1,3-dihydro-1-methyl-(9CI) is a chemical compound with the molecular formula C8H8FN3S. It belongs to the class of benzimidazole derivatives, which are heterocyclic compounds containing a benzene ring fused to an imidazole ring. This specific compound features a fluorine atom at the 5-position, a methyl group at the 1-position, and a sulfur atom at the 2-position, forming a thione group. It is an important intermediate in the synthesis of various pharmaceuticals and agrochemicals due to its unique structure and properties. The compound is also known for its potential applications in the development of new drugs targeting various diseases, such as cancer and bacterial infections.

Check Digit Verification of cas no

The CAS Registry Mumber 704-51-8 includes 6 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 3 digits, 7,0 and 4 respectively; the second part has 2 digits, 5 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 704-51:
(5*7)+(4*0)+(3*4)+(2*5)+(1*1)=58
58 % 10 = 8
So 704-51-8 is a valid CAS Registry Number.

Benzimidazole derivative and preparation method and application thereof

-

Paragraph 0067; 0068; 0069; 0070, (2018/10/11)

The invention discloses a benzimidazole derivative and a preparation method and application thereof. The structure of the benzimidazole derivative is as shown in the general formula I in the specification. The benzimidazole derivative has characteristics of high efficiency and low toxicity, prevention and treatment, stable quality, convenience in use, effectiveness in both oral administration andinjection and the like, can directly confront multi-system injuries caused by radiation, and effectively alleviate symptoms of acute radiation sickness to save precious time for subsequent comprehensive treatment. The invention provides a new thinking and direction for the development of a safe and highly-efficient radioprotector.
